Is pregnancy stress common?

Pregnancy is a time of massive changes which affect your body physically and mentally, as well as all aspects of your lifestyle. During this time, up to 84% of women experience perinatal stress whilst perinatal anxiety affects approximately 17% of women.

What causes pregnancy stress?

Before we jump into the 5 essential oils that can help alleviate pregnancy stress, let’s take a look at what might be causing it:

  • Worries about pregnancy loss

  • Worries about labor and delivery

  • Pregnancy symptoms like nausea, tiredness, and mood swings

  • Physical changes you’re experiencing

  • Worry about telling work you are pregnant and preparing for maternity leave

  • Financial concerns

  • Feeling stressed about feeling stressed — worry about whether stress is dangerous for your baby can cause you to feel more stress during pregnancy

Can pregnancy stress cause miscarriage?

Whilst we know that stress isn’t good for your overall health, a 2018 study of 344 women found no link between miscarriage and stress, and stress is not linked to an increased chance of miscarriage.

Some studies have suggested there is an indirect link between stress and miscarriage, which could make it a risk factor, but more evidence is needed to prove this link.

Unfortunately, around 10-20% of all known pregnancies end in miscarriage. Most miscarriages occur because the fetus isn't developing as expected and there’s nothing that can be done to prevent it. This doesn’t make the loss any easier, but it’s important to know that experiencing pregnancy stress isn’t going to cause a miscarriage, so try not to let that fear lead to more stress.

What can help alleviate pregnancy stress?

  1. Talk to someone you trust. Try to talk to friends, family, your partner, or a doctor about how you are feeling. Saying it out loud and processing any fears or worries can really help.
